Summary
TTIs are small, inexpensive labels stuck onto the packaging of a food product, making it possible to visualize the freshness of the food in question. The label changes colour as a function of duration and the temperature and thus gives information on the shelf life. This study was aimed at defining the product life stage during which the TTIs must be first stuck onto the packaging and then activated.
